Abstract
DC machine is widely used in the industrial production and daily life and speed adjustment of DC machine has got more and more attention. With the development of electronic technology, the method for speed adjustment has been in great change correspondingly, from analog circuit to digital circuit, from SCM to control system. Speed adjustment of DC machine has got improved greatly.
Having experienced the development of 8-bit, 16-bit and 32-bit, MCU has got dramatic improvement in control and processing speed. Processor in ARM system is mostly used in current embedded system. It takes RISC technology, with characteristics such as small volume, low power consumption, advanced function. Registers are greatly used in inner chip, instruction executes fast and with fixed length, which enables processor works fast with high effectiveness. As Linux supports ARM technology, has inner core can be downsizing and open codes, so applying Linux to embedded system can give fully play to ARM and Linux advantages.
Taking LPC2290 as an example, this design introduces the hardware and software design of this system in detail.
